Islamic arts exhibition opens today

‘Seed of Peace: The Sower and the Envoy,’ an Islamic art exhibition opens today  at the National Museum Gallery, Onikan, Lagos.
It is a solo exposition of over 40 works of Ridwan Oshinowo, an artist under the Halal Art Grallemeo, and is supported by Ibeji Foundation and the Forum for Islamic Welfare and Education.
Works in calligraphy and other decorative patterns in painting will treat various themes including houses of worships, people, and places.
Dr. Wale Babalakin, SAN, Managing Director of Bi-Courtney Ltd, will chair the opening ceremony, while His Eminence, Sultan of Sokoto, Alhaji Abubakar Sa’ad, is Royal Father of the day.
The week-long exhibition will close with an inter-faith gathering to engage speakers and audience, Muslims and Christians and other concerned faithful on how to achieve peaceful co-existence among different religions.
